Becoming Globally Friendly is a consultation designed to address perhaps the biggest challenge with which traditional mission organizations currently wrestle: knowing how to effectively engage the majority world missions movement. The Lord has given much fruit from years of sacrificial service evidenced by the transformation of a mission field into a mission force. However, few anticipated the impact and complications this would bring North American sending organizations as they look for ways to work with and alongside of this new mission force.
This gathering will pull together decision makers from many key international missions who are seeking to adapt to the new reality of global missions where missionaries come from countries that were, until recently, considered mission fields. It seems that everyone is asking, “How can we change our organization so it is friendly to the new global reality?”
